Does a late positive pregnancy test cause for late morning sickness?

By pregnantnews

I just now got a positive pregnancy test at 6 1/2 weeks, does that mean my morning sickness will start later than most women who get a positive before they even miss their period?

Not everyone gets morning sickness, and not everyone gets it at the same time. I don’t think that the pregnancy test is any indication of this. I have been through 4 pregnancies and I am in my 5th. They have all been different. Sometimes you don’t experience morning sickness at all, sometimes at the begining, sometimes in the middle, and sometimes not until the end. I learned that as long as you eat before you are hungry, keep snacking all day, you don’t really get sick that bad. But it doesn’t always help. Congratulations and best wishes on your pregnancy ♥
